Per Josh Gershon of Scout.com, Kobe Paras has just committed to Creighton University.

Paras, as Gershon tweets, was a former UCLA Bruins signee but withdrew due to academic issues last month. Weeks later, it appears that all might be clear for Paras, a standout shooting guard originally from the Philippines, to join the Bluejays. Paras was set to join the Class of 2016 for UCLA so one should expect Paras to suit up for Creighton, if all goes well, later this fall.
Paras represented his home country in the SEABA U16 Championship back in 2013 where the team won a gold medal in the event. He also took part in the FIBA Asia U18 3x3 championship in which his team won gold as well. He is a three-star recruit via 247Sports and ranks highest on Scout where he is listed as a four-star recruit.
He would join Davion Mintz as incoming freshmen for the Jays this coming season if and when he sees the floor.
